If the fallopian tubes are blocked, fertilization can't happen. Fallopian tube recanalization helps open blocked tubes to improve a woman's chances of becoming pregnant. This surgery is also called "Tubal Reversal," also called "Tubal Sterilization Reversal," or "Tubal Ligation Reversal," or ... Microsurgical sutures are used to precisely align the tubal lumens (inside canal of tube), the muscular portion (muscularis externa), and the outer serosa.Robotic Tubal Recanalization, Tubal Sterilization Reversal, or Tubal Ligation Reversal at World Laparoscopy Hospital

Robotic tubal recanalization is a precise procedure designed to restore patency to blocked fallopian tubes. Unlike traditional open surgeries, robotic assistance allows surgeons to operate with high magnification, enhanced dexterity, and steady, tremor-free movements. This technological advantage ensures that delicate structures of the fallopian tube are preserved, which is crucial for improving the chances of natural conception. Tubal sterilization reversal, also known as tubal ligation reversal, is sought by women who have undergone sterilization procedures earlier in life but later wish to conceive. Traditionally, this was a complex open surgery with longer recovery times and increased risk of complications. With robotic-assisted reversal, surgeons can reconnect the cut or blocked segments of the fallopian tube using microsurgical precision. The procedure not only increases the probability of successful pregnancy but also significantly reduces post-operative pain, hospital stay, and recovery duration.
